A Look at Upcoming Innovations in Electric and Autonomous Vehicles Obrazovanje u Programiranju: Razvijanje Veština Kodiranja

Obrazovanje u Programiranju: Razvijanje Veština Kodiranja

Da li ste ikada poželeli da razumete tajne digitalnog sveta koji nas okružuje? Da pretvorite svoje ideje u aplikacije, sajtove ili čak igre? Ako ste ikada osetili taj nemir, želju da stvorite nešto novo, ali i strah od nepoznatog, niste sami. Svet programiranja deluje kao tajanstveni lavirint za mnoge, ali istina je da svako može postati deo njega. Danas ćemo zajedno zakoračiti u ovu avanturu, razbiti mitove i pokazati vam kako programiranje za početnike može biti ne samo dostižno, već i uzbudljivo putovanje.

Zašto je programiranje toliko daleko, a opet tako blizu?

Sećam se svog prvog susreta sa programiranjem. Bio sam uveren da je to nešto što rade samo genijalci u filmovima, oni likovi koji kucaju munjevito po tastaturi dok na ekranu izlaze beskonačne linije koda. Realnost? Nisam mogao ni da shvatim šta znači "Hello, World" u prvom programu koji sam pokušao da napišem. Frustracija je bila ogromna. Ali upravo taj trenutak me naučio nečemu važnom – programiranje nije rezervnisano za "odabrane". To je veština koju svako može savladati, korak po korak. Problem nije u nedostatku talenta, već u pristupu i resursima. Mnogi od nas nemaju pojma odakle da počnu, koji programski jezici su najlakši za učenje, ili kako da pronađu prave alate za početak.

Svet se menja brzinom svetlosti, a tehnologija je postala deo svakog aspekta našeg života. Od aplikacija koje koristimo svaki dan do složenih sistema koji pokreću globalnu ekonomiju, programiranje je srce svega. Ipak, uprkos toj sveprisutnosti, mnogi osećaju da je ulazak u ovu oblast gotovo nemoguć. Škole često ne nude dovoljno praktične nastave, a privatni kursevi mogu biti skupi. Kako onda premostiti taj jaz? Tu dolazimo do zanimljivog primera – zamislite da je učenje programiranja poput pripreme za veliku utakmicu, recimo plej of za svetsko prvenstvo 2026. Potrebna je strategija, timski duh i pravi resursi da biste stigli do cilja. Srećom, danas postoje brojni načini da se pripremite i bez velikih ulaganja.

Kako započeti bez straha i velikih troškova?

Sada kada smo razbili mit da je programiranje nedostižno, hajde da se pozabavimo rešenjima koja su na dohvat ruke. Prva dobra vest je da ne morate da potrošite čitavo bogatstvo da biste naučili osnove. Besplatni kursevi programiranja dostupni su na raznim platformama i nude sve – od uvoda u programiranje za početnike do naprednih lekcija. Ovi kursevi su često interaktivni, što znači da možete odmah da primenite ono što učite i vidite rezultate svog rada.

Druga stvar koju treba da razmotrite jeste izbor pravog programskog jezika za početak. Nisu svi programski jezici podjednako teški, niti su svi namenjeni istim ciljevima. Ako ste potpuni novajlija, Python je odličan izbor. Python kurs može vam pomoći da shvatite osnovne koncepte kodiranja na jednostavan način, jer je sintaksa ovog jezika veoma čitljiva, gotovo kao običan tekst. S druge strane, ako želite da se bavite razvojem aplikacija ili poslovnih sistema, Java kurs bi mogao biti pravi put za vas. Java je robustan jezik koji se koristi u mnogim velikim kompanijama, pa učenje ovog jezika otvara vrata ka ozbiljnim karijerama.

Ako niste sigurni odakle da počnete, evo kratke liste popularnih opcija za učenje:

  • Python – idealan za početnike, koristi se za veb razvoj, nauku o podacima i veštačku inteligenciju.
  • Java – odličan za poslovne aplikacije i Android razvoj.
  • JavaScript – ključan za veb dizajn i interaktivne sajtove.

Osim toga, IT kursevi dostupni na internetu često pokrivaju širok spektar tema, pa možete pronaći nešto što odgovara vašim interesovanjima, bilo da je reč o razvoju igara, analizi podataka ili kibernetičkoj bezbednosti. Ključno je da ne žurite – učenje programiranja je proces koji zahteva strpljenje, ali svaki mali korak vas vodi bliže velikoj slici.

Da li ste znali da je prosečna plata programera u Srbiji znatno viša od mnogih drugih profesija, čak i za one koji tek počinju? To je samo jedan od razloga zašto sve više ljudi traži načine da se uključi u ovu branšu. Ali nije reč samo o novcu – programiranje vam daje moć da stvarate, da rešavate probleme, da menjate svet oko sebe. Zamislite da jednog dana napravite aplikaciju koja pomaže hiljadama ljudi, ili da automatizujete dosadan posao koji oduzima sate. Sve počinje sa prvim korakom, a taj korak možete napraviti već danas.

Na kraju, hajde da budemo iskreni – učenje programiranja nije uvek lako. Biće dana kada ćete se boriti sa greškama u kodu, kada nećete razumeti zašto nešto ne radi. Ali upravo ti trenuci vas čine boljim. Svaka greška je lekcija, svaki rešen problem je pobeda. Ako ste spremni da uložite vreme i trud, svet programiranja može postati vaš dom. Dakle, šta čekate? Pronađite besplatni kurs, izaberite jezik koji vas privlači i krenite. Put nije kratak, ali je svakako vredan truda.

Obrazovanje u Programiranju: Razvijanje Veština Kodiranja

Zašto je Programiranje Važno u Današnjem Svetu?

Programiranje je postalo jedna od ključnih veština 21. veka. Bilo da želite da pokrenete sopstveni startap, radite u tehnološkoj industriji ili jednostavno razumete kako digitalni svet funkcioniše, osnovne veštine kodiranja su neophodne. Prema istraživanjima, potražnja za stručnjacima u oblasti informacionih tehnologija raste za 15% godišnje, što čini programiranje za početnike idealnom polaznom tačkom za mnoge karijere.

Osim profesionalnih benefita, učenje programiranja razvija logičko razmišljanje i sposobnost rešavanja problema. Na primer, kada početnik uči osnove preko besplatnih kurseva programiranja, on ne samo da stekne tehničko znanje, već i uči kako da razbije složene probleme na manje, upravljive delove.

Koji Programski Jezici su Najbolji za Početnike?

Izbor pravog programskog jezika zavisi od vaših ciljeva i interesovanja. Postoji mnogo programskih jezika koji su prilagođeni različitim potrebama, ali za one koji tek počinju, određeni jezici su lakši za učenje i pružaju široku primenu.

  • Python: Smatra se jednim od najlakših jezika za učenje zbog svoje jednostavne sintakse. Python kurs je odličan izbor za početnike jer omogućava rad na projektima u oblastima kao što su veštačka inteligencija, analiza podataka i veb razvoj.
  • Java: Ovaj jezik je široko rasprostranjen u poslovnom svetu i koristi se za razvoj aplikacija i softvera. Učenje preko Java kursa može otvoriti vrata za poslove u velikim korporacijama.
  • JavaScript: Idealno za one koji žele da rade na veb razvoju, jer se koristi za interaktivne elemente na veb stranicama.

Ako niste sigurni odakle da počnete, razmislite o tome šta vas motiviše. Želite li da pravite mobilne aplikacije, veb stranice ili da radite na analitici podataka? Odgovor na ovo pitanje pomoći će vam da izaberete pravi jezik i odgovarajuće it kurseve.

Gde Pronaći Kvalitetne Resurse za Učenje?

Besplatni Resursi i Kursevi

Internet je prepun mogućnosti za učenje programiranja bez troškova. Besplatni kursevi programiranja dostupni su na platformama poput Coursera, edX i Khan Academy. Na primer, Coursera nudi besplatne uvodne kurseve za Python i Java, gde možete učiti sopstvenim tempom.

Osim toga, YouTube kanali i blogovi često pružaju korisne tutorijale za programiranje za početnike. Jedan od primera je kanal Freecodecamp, koji nudi detaljne video lekcije o različitim programskim jezicima i tehnologijama.

Plaćeni Kursevi i Sertifikati

Ako ste spremni da investirate u svoje obrazovanje, it kursevi sa sertifikatima mogu biti odličan izbor. Platforme poput Udemy i Pluralsight nude detaljne programe, uključujući Python kurs ili Java kurs, koji često dolaze sa praktičnim projektima i podrškom mentora.

Prednost plaćenih kurseva je struktura i posvećenost koju donose. Na primer, učenik koji upiše kurs na Udemy često ima pristup zajednici drugih polaznika, što olakšava razmenu ideja i rešavanje problema.

Kako Započeti Put u Programiranju?

Prvi korak je postavljanje realnih ciljeva. Nemojte očekivati da ćete postati stručnjak preko noći. Evo nekoliko koraka koje možete pratiti:

  • Izaberite jedan programski jezik i fokusirajte se na njega. Ako ste početnik, preporučujemo Python kurs zbog njegove jednostavnosti.
  • Pronađite besplatne ili plaćene resurse, poput besplatnih kurseva programiranja, i posvetite vreme redovnom učenju.
  • Radite na malim projektima. Na primer, ako učite Python, pokušajte da napravite jednostavan kalkulator ili igru pogađanja brojeva.
  • Pridružite se zajednicama na forumima poput Stack Overflow, gde možete postavljati pitanja i učiti od drugih programera.

Ključno je da ostanete uporni. Programiranje može biti izazovno na početku, ali svaki rešen problem donosi novo samopouzdanje. Postavite sebi pitanje: šta želim da postignem programiranjem? Odgovor na ovo pitanje biće vaš vodič.

Česta Pitanja i Dodatni Saveti

Mnogi početnici se pitaju koliko vremena je potrebno da nauče programiranje. Istina je da to zavisi od vašeg tempa i posvećenosti. Prosečno, osnovno razumevanje jezika poput Pythona može se postići za 3-6 meseci uz redovno učenje od 2-3 sata dnevno.

Takođe, važno je da ne preskačete osnove. Iako je primamljivo da odmah pređete na složene projekte, razumevanje osnovnih koncepata kao što su petlje, funkcije i promenljive je ključno za dugoročni uspeh.

Ako razmišljate o karijeri u programiranju, razmotrite i dodatne veštine poput upravljanja bazama podataka ili razvoja veb aplikacija. Pronalaženje pravih it kurseva može vam pomoći da izgradite zaokružen set veština koji je tražen na tržištu rada.